为何服务器访问会被拒绝访问权限?
当您尝试访问服务器时遇到“访问被拒绝”或“访问权限不足”的错误提示,这通常意味着您的请求未能通过服务器的安全验证,这种情况可能由多种原因造成,下面是一些常见的原因及其详细解释:
1、身份验证失败:如果您使用的是需要登录的系统(如Windows域、数据库、Web应用等),可能是因为提供的用户名和/或密码不正确,确保输入的信息无误,并且账户状态正常(未被锁定或禁用)。
2、用户权限不足:即使身份验证成功,如果分配给用户的权限不足以执行所请求的操作,也会收到访问拒绝的消息,尝试读取一个文件但当前用户没有该文件的读取权限。
3、IP地址限制:某些服务器配置了防火墙规则或者安全策略,仅允许特定IP地址范围内的设备进行连接,如果您的IP不在允许列表中,则会被拒绝访问。
4、端口号错误:每项服务都运行在特定的TCP/UDP端口上,如果客户端试图通过错误的端口号来访问服务,那么即使目标服务器在线且可到达,也将无法建立连接。
5、网络问题:包括但不限于DNS解析失败、路由设置不当、物理链路故障等导致的数据包传输障碍,都可能表现为看似是“访问权限”的问题但实际上是更底层的网络连通性问题。
6、服务未启动/不可用:目标服务器上相应的服务可能尚未启动,或者因为维护、崩溃等原因暂时不可用,在这种情况下,任何尝试与其通信的行为都会以失败告终。
7、安全软件拦截:安装在客户端或服务器端的防火墙、入侵检测系统(IDS)、防病毒软件等可能会基于预设规则阻止某些类型的流量,从而造成看似无故的访问拒绝。
8、资源限制:并不是由于安全性考虑而是因为资源耗尽(如CPU利用率过高、内存不足)导致新的连接请求无法得到处理。
解决这类问题的一般步骤包括检查并确认所有相关信息是否正确无误(如URL、端口号、凭证等),查看相关日志文件寻找线索,联系管理员获取帮助等,对于具体情境下的最佳解决方案,则需要根据实际情况灵活应对。
各位小伙伴们,我刚刚为大家分享了有关“服务器访问被拒绝访问权限”的知识,希望对你们有所帮助。如果您还有其他相关问题需要解决,欢迎随时提出哦!
暂无评论,1人围观